Newcastle United boss Alan Pardew says Mike Ashley now feels far more comfortable in charge of the club.
Ashley is now presiding over a far healthier club, and after seeing the Magpies fight back to snatch a derby draw with Sunderland at the weekend, he is clearly enjoying his tenure more than he has at times in the recent past.
"But for us as a club, it's important he has a good hold of the football club and a good psychology towards it, which I think he has at the moment.
"We are just going to try to grow with the financial discipline that we have."Pardew said: "He thoroughly enjoyed Sunday - he thought it was 'good theatre', those were his words, and it probably was.
